Disciplinary Letter for the United Kingdom

Disciplinary Letter Template for England and Wales

A Disciplinary Letter is a formal written communication under English and Welsh law that documents misconduct or performance issues and outlines specific disciplinary actions being taken against an employee. It forms part of the formal disciplinary process and must comply with employment law requirements, including the ACAS Code of Practice. The letter serves as an official record of the disciplinary action and may be crucial in potential future employment tribunal proceedings.

What is a Disciplinary Letter?

A Disciplinary Letter is a crucial document in the formal employee disciplinary process under English and Welsh law. It should be issued following a proper investigation and disciplinary hearing, documenting specific incidents of misconduct or performance issues, the evidence considered, and the resulting disciplinary action. The letter must comply with the ACAS Code of Practice and relevant employment legislation, providing clear information about the issue, consequences, required improvements, and appeal rights. This document serves both as a formal record and a legal safeguard for employers while ensuring fair treatment of employees.

What sections should be included in a Disciplinary Letter?

1. Letter Header: Company details, date, employee details, marking as 'Private and Confidential'

2. Issue Description: Clear statement of the misconduct or performance issue

3. Evidence Reference: Specific incidents, dates, and evidence supporting the disciplinary action

4. Action Taken: Clear statement of the disciplinary action being taken

5. Next Steps: What the employee needs to do to improve/comply

6. Right to Appeal: Information about appeal process and timeframes

What sections are optional to include in a Disciplinary Letter?

1. Previous Warnings: Reference to previous warnings if applicable

2. Support Offered: Details of any additional support or training available

3. Union Representative: Reference to right to union representation if applicable

What schedules should be included in a Disciplinary Letter?

1. Evidence Documents: Copies of relevant evidence or investigation findings

2. Company Policies: Relevant excerpts from company policies being enforced

3. Appeal Procedure: Detailed explanation of appeal process
